3 Essential Guidelines for Buying Fences
Before you head off to the showroom to pick out a new fence, do yourself a favor and learn what you need to look for, first. All you really need is some kind of idea about what you want and why, and then maybe talk to a fence professional who can lead you through the rest. After you know what you want, then it's just a matter of more research and refining your search. This content is purely about what to do before buying fences, and that's what you'll learn how to do in part.
It's a good idea to have the resale value in mind that a good, high quality fence can provide, but not all fences will significantly add anything to the future selling price. So when you are choosing fence materials, you really don't want to go with something that is cheap and unpleasant to look at. Plus if you want to have privacy and other things like security, then that type of fence will allow you to be out back and feel secluded. From choosing the right fence made from quality materials to complying with appropriate local laws, there's a lot for you to know.
If you want to save money and install the fence yourself, then you'll need to look for a fence that is not as involved as others and is a more simpler design, and you may not be able to get exactly what you want. If you want something like a security fence, then this may be out of your ability to install. The proper tool for holes is a post hole digging tool, and there are different kinds you can rent. But you can always go the usual route and hire a fencing contractor.
Nothing at all unusual about a fence that is just to keep some privacy even if people can see over the fence. Even a simple wood fence will work in this instance because it's there and kids won't climb over it just to pass through your property. Any type of fence will get the job done, but you also should stop and think about how nice it will look. The question of what to look for really just depends on the type of fence you decide to get.
